We can break fish into two categories. Bony and Cartilage fish. Bony fish such as Salmon, trout and clown fish have an endoskeleton made of bone, swim bladder and an operculum which covers the gills.

Bony fish, essentially ‘drink’ water and instead of swallowing it, push it out their gills.








Cartilage fish, such as sharks have an endoskeleton made of cartilage, no swim bladder and no operculum. This means you can see their 5 gill split easily.

Larger fish like sharks must constantly move with their mouth open, letting water pass in and out directly through the gills.
